Find the equation of a line that passes through the point (2-5) and has a gradient of -1/2
Leave your answer in the formy=mx+C

Answer:

y = -1/2x - 4

Step-by-step explanation:

Put in the formula y=mx+c the slope and the point (2,-5)

-5= -1/2(2) + c

Find C to get the y value of the line

-5 = -1 + c

c= -4

Now fill the formula with the values you found

y = -1/2x - 4

m= -1/2

c= -4
